Island Escapes: Beyond Jeju
While Jeju Island is a popular destination, South Korea boasts a plethora of other stunning islands, each with its unique charm. Consider a trip to Namhae Island, renowned for its breathtaking coastal scenery, picturesque villages, and the iconic Gwangan Bridge. Hike through lush green hills, explore charming fishing villages, and indulge in the freshest seafood. Alternatively, explore the volcanic beauty of Ulleungdo Island, a remote paradise with dramatic cliffs, pristine beaches, and unique flora and fauna. The journey to these islands is part of the adventure, often involving scenic ferry rides that offer stunning ocean vistas.
Ancient History Off the Beaten Track:
While Gyeongju, the ancient capital, is a must-visit, delve deeper into Korea's rich history by exploring lesser-known historical sites. Visit the serene Bulguksa Temple in Gyeongju, a UNESCO World Heritage site, and marvel at its exquisite architecture. But venture further afield to discover hidden temples nestled in the mountains, such as the magnificent Beomeosa Temple in Busan, or the serene Haeinsa Temple, home to the Tripitaka Koreana, a collection of Buddhist scriptures carved onto wooden blocks. These tranquil settings offer a unique perspective on Korea's spiritual heritage.
Charming Villages and Rural Landscapes:
Escape the hustle and bustle of city life by exploring South Korea's picturesque villages. Andong Hahoe Folk Village offers a glimpse into traditional Korean life, with beautifully preserved hanoks (traditional Korean houses) and captivating folk performances. In Jeonju, delve into the Hanok Village, a labyrinth of traditional houses, craft workshops, and delicious street food. These villages are a testament to Korea's rich cultural heritage, offering a slower pace of life and a chance to connect with the local community.
Demilitarized Zone (DMZ) Tour: A Unique Perspective:
A visit to the DMZ, the border between North and South Korea, offers a poignant and thought-provoking experience. Guided tours provide a glimpse into the history of the Korean War and the ongoing division of the peninsula. While it's a sobering experience, it offers a unique perspective on geopolitics and the complexities of the Korean Peninsula. Remember to book a tour in advance, as access is restricted.
Hiking and Nature Escapes: Beyond the Cityscapes:
South Korea boasts stunning natural beauty, extending beyond the iconic Seoraksan National Park. Explore the Jirisan National Park, the largest national park in South Korea, renowned for its diverse flora and fauna, challenging hiking trails, and breathtaking views. For a more relaxed experience, consider a scenic hike along the coastal trails of the South Coast, enjoying the fresh sea air and stunning ocean vistas. Pack your hiking boots and immerse yourself in the serene beauty of South Korea's natural landscapes.
Experiencing Local Culture: Beyond the Tourist Traps:
Engage with local culture by attending traditional Korean performances, such as Nongak (farmers' music) or pansori (a genre of Korean musical storytelling). Visit local markets, sample regional specialties, and interact with friendly locals. Take a Korean cooking class and learn the art of preparing bibimbap or kimchi. These authentic experiences provide a deeper understanding of Korean culture and create lasting memories.
Transportation Tips for Exploring Hidden Gems:
South Korea boasts an efficient and reliable public transportation system, making it easy to explore even the most remote areas. Utilize the extensive subway network in major cities and take advantage of the comfortable and affordable intercity bus services. For reaching more remote islands or villages, consider renting a car, though driving in larger cities can be challenging. Be sure to download a translation app and learn a few basic Korean phrases to enhance your travel experience.
Accommodation Options: From Traditional to Modern:
From traditional hanoks offering a unique cultural experience to modern hotels catering to every budget, South Korea offers a wide range of accommodation options. For a truly immersive experience, consider staying in a hanok in a village like Jeonju or Andong. For a more convenient and modern stay, choose from a variety of hotels and guesthouses in larger cities.
